Understanding the Importance of Quality

Quality assurance in precision plastic mold parts can't be overstated. Issues such as dimensional inaccuracies, surface defects, or material inconsistencies can lead to significant problems during production. These issues can result in high rejection rates, costly reworks, and delays in delivery, ultimately impacting customer satisfaction and trust.

Customer Impact of Using Substandard Parts

Substandard precision plastic mold parts can lead to defects in the final products, causing dissatisfaction among end-users. Customers relying on precision parts for sensitive applications, such as automotive, medical devices, and electronics, expect the highest standards. When products fail to meet these expectations, it can lead to a loss of reputation and revenue for manufacturers, creating a ripple effect throughout the supply chain.

Tip 1: Evaluate Material Selection

The choice of material is fundamental to the performance of precision plastic mold parts. Different materials offer various benefits and drawbacks, such as heat resistance, strength, and flexibility. Therefore, it's essential to evaluate the specific requirements of your application and select materials that can meet those needs reliably.

Tip 2: Work with Reputable Suppliers

Choosing an experienced and reputable supplier is key to ensuring quality. Look for suppliers that provide detailed specifications, certifications, and testing results for their precision plastic mold parts. Engaging in a transparent dialogue with suppliers about their quality assurance processes can help mitigate risks associated with substandard components.

Tip 3: Inspect Prototype Parts

Before committing to a large order, always inspect prototype precision plastic mold parts. Prototyping allows for a thorough review of the parts’ dimensions, tolerances, and surface finishes. This inspection stage is crucial for identifying any potential issues before large-scale production begins.

Tip 4: Implement Quality Control Measures

Quality control is vital for maintaining the standard of precision plastic mold parts throughout production. Implement a stringent quality control process that includes in-line inspections, testing, and validation of parts, ensuring that any defects are identified and addressed quickly. Utilizing techniques such as Statistical Process Control (SPC) can be an effective way to monitor and enhance quality standards.

Tip 5: Understand Design Considerations

Design plays a critical role in the effectiveness of precision plastic mold parts. Ensure that designs account for factors such as shrinkage, material flow, and cooling time. Collaborate with engineers and mold designers to optimize designs, ensuring smooth production and manufacturing processes that yield high-quality outcomes.

Tip 6: Stay Updated on Industry Standards

Industries are continually evolving, and so are the standards for precision plastic mold parts. It is important to stay updated on the latest regulations, guidelines, and best practices related to materials and manufacturing processes. Regular training and workshops can equip your team with the knowledge required to meet these standards.

Tip 7: Invest in Technology and Equipment

Investing in advanced manufacturing technology can significantly improve the quality of precision plastic mold parts. CNC machining, 3D printing, and injection molding technologies allow for greater accuracy and efficiency. By upgrading equipment, you can minimize defects and streamline production, ensuring better end products.
